Wife and I had been wanting to try Mei Wah for a while and we finally both had a Saturday off together (the restaurant is closed Sundays and Mondays). We tried to open the door and it was locked. Apparently it's all just take out business from the takeout window (you can walk up to it). The employees we spoke to were both very friendly. The menu is fairly traditional for Chinese food. The vegetable fried rice was very good and it's one of the very few places I've been to in the region that uses egg in their fried rice. The lo mein was good with the perfect amount of sesame oil but the noodles were fettuccine pasta, not real lo mein noodles. The General Tso chicken was cooked well but it was more of an orange chicken than General Tso. Overall we were happy with the restaurant and will be back. It's the best Chinese food we've had in Dillon.
